Understanding Marital vs. Separate Home
When browsing home division in a separation, it's vital to understand the distinctions between marital and separate home.
Marital residential property consists of properties and debts acquired during the marital relationship, no matter whose name is on the title. This can include homes, vehicles, and shared bank accounts.
On the other hand, different property consists of possessions you possessed prior to the marital relationship or gotten as presents or inheritances particularly indicated for you.
It's important to determine which possessions fall into each category, as this distinction can significantly affect the department procedure. Knowing these differences can help you protect your interests and ensure a reasonable end result.

Tips to Protect Your Passions Throughout Property Division
Securing your rate of interests throughout property department is vital, especially in the psychological landscape of a divorce. Begin by collecting all economic files, consisting of financial institution declarations, tax returns, and residential property actions. This info assists clarify your properties and obligations.
Next, take into consideration working with an experienced lawyer who can promote for your civil liberties and ensure you recognize your alternatives. Do not fail to remember to assess the value of shared residential or commercial property precisely; getting an expert appraisal can make a distinction.
Connect openly with your spouse regarding your demands and issues, as this can bring about even more friendly arrangements.
Last but not least, remain arranged and maintain documents of all interactions related to residential or commercial property division, guaranteeing you have whatever recorded for future recommendation.
